More about electrical and instrumentation technician courses in Taree

If you're looking to kickstart your career in the electrical and instrumentation field, the Electrical and Instrumentation Technician courses in Taree provide a comprehensive pathway for both beginners and those with prior experience. With a total of 13 courses available in Taree, there is an educational opportunity here for everyone, regardless of your current skill level. Whether you are venturing into this field for the first time or seeking to advance your existing knowledge, there are options tailored for your needs.

For newcomers, beginner courses such as the Certificate III in Instrumentation and Control UEE31220 and the Apply Work Health and Safety Regulations, Codes and Practices in the Workplace UEECD0007 are great starting points. These courses not only equip you with fundamental skills but are also recognised by RTOs in Taree, ensuring high-quality training that meets industry standards. Completing these courses can set you on a rewarding path towards a variety of roles, including that of a Instrumentation Technician.

For those with some experience, advanced courses such as the Advanced Diploma of Electrical and Instrumentation (E&I) Engineering in Mining 52892WA and the Certificate IV in Hazardous Areas - Electrical UEE42622 present wonderful opportunities for further enhancement of skills. These courses prepare you for significant job roles, such as a Engineering Tradesperson or an Mining Supervisor, allowing you to take on greater responsibilities in your workplace.

The education available in Taree also covers specialised fields like oil and gas and mining. Courses focused on these industries, found in Oil and Gas and Mining, are designed to meet the demands of these sectors, ensuring that you are well-prepared for the challenges and opportunities in these dynamic environments. Completing programmes such as the Advanced Diploma of Electrical and Instrumentation (E&I) Engineering for Oil and Gas Facilities 52882WA could position you for roles such as Oil and Gas Engineer or even Drilling Engineer.
